1. Broker Overview
Energy Global, officially known as Energy Global B.V., was established in the Netherlands. The company is headquartered in Rotterdam, where it operates its main office. As a private company, Energy Global has been actively engaging in the forex trading market for approximately 2 to 5 years. The broker primarily serves retail and institutional clients interested in trading various financial instruments across multiple markets.
The company's development has been marked by its focus on providing a diverse range of trading services, including forex, commodities, and CFDs. However, it is crucial to note that Energy Global operates without any valid regulatory oversight, which raises significant concerns regarding investor protection and fund security. The absence of regulatory licensing is a major red flag for potential clients.
Energy Global's business model revolves around offering retail forex services, allowing clients to trade a variety of currency pairs and financial derivatives. The company targets both novice and experienced traders, providing them with the necessary tools and resources to navigate the complexities of the forex market.
As the Energy Global broker continues to expand its reach, it remains essential for potential clients to conduct thorough due diligence before engaging with the platform.
Energy Global operates without any valid regulatory licenses, which poses a significant risk to its clients. The lack of oversight from recognized regulatory bodies means that there are no guarantees regarding the safety of client funds or the adherence to industry standards.
- Regulatory Status: No valid regulatory information.
- Regulatory Agencies: Energy Global does not fall under any recognized regulatory authority, which is a major concern for potential clients.
- Client Fund Protection: The absence of regulatory oversight means that there are no policies in place for client fund segregation or protection.
- Investor Compensation Fund: Energy Global does not participate in any investor compensation schemes, leaving clients vulnerable in case of broker insolvency.
- KYC and AML Compliance: While specific details on KYC (Know Your Customer) and AML (Anti-Money Laundering) measures are not provided, the lack of regulation raises questions about the effectiveness of these measures.
In summary, the Energy Global broker lacks the necessary regulatory framework to ensure the safety and security of its clients, making it imperative for potential investors to exercise caution.
